Hiking in Ankara offers access to diverse landscapes, from serene lakes to expansive national parks and unique geological formations, all within reach of the city. The region is characterized by a mix of wooded areas, open waters, and varied terrain, providing a range of outdoor experiences. Hikers can explore areas featuring volcanic lakes, canyons, and lush parklands. These natural settings provide opportunities for different levels of physical activity.

Ankara offers a diverse range of hiking trails, from serene lakeside strolls around places like Eymir Lake to more challenging treks through national parks such as Soğuksu National Park. You can also find routes exploring canyons, valleys, and urban green spaces. The region features a mix of wooded areas, open waters, and varied terrain, catering to different preferences and fitness levels.
Yes, Ankara has several easy trails perfect for beginners or families. For an urban escape, consider the Kugulu Park – Seğmenler Park loop from Çankaya, an easy 6.0 km route through city parks. Lakeside areas like Eymir Lake also offer gentle paths for nature walks and cycling, providing a tranquil experience away from the city bustle.
For more challenging hikes, Soğuksu National Park is an excellent choice. It features routes like the Fosil Ağaç loop from Yenice, a difficult 17.4 km trail with significant elevation changes. The İnözü Valley near Beypazarı and the Köroğlu Mountains also offer more demanding terrain and breathtaking views for experienced hikers.
Many of Ankara's popular hiking routes are circular,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Parking Area by the Lake – View of the Lake loop from Delta Macera around Lake Eymir, and the Fosil Ağaç loop from Soğuksu National Park. These loops offer varied scenery without the need for a return trip.
Yes, for those seeking waterfalls, Cyprus Canyon (Kıbrıs Köyü Kanyonu) is a notable option. Located just a short drive from the city, a creek runs along the base of the valley, leading to a waterfall. Additionally, Uyuzsuyu Waterfall is a popular spot for day trips, known for its relaxing ambiance.
Ankara's hiking areas are rich with natural beauty. You can explore the volcanic Karagöl Nature Park, the diverse landscapes of Soğuksu National Park, or the tranquil shores of Eymir and Mogan Lakes. Further afield, the Nallıhan District features the unique 'Rainbow Hills' and a significant bird sanctuary. For historical landmarks, consider visiting Ankara Castle or Anıtkabir, which are accessible from some urban routes.

Absolutely. Eymir Lake is a popular choice for easy walks and cycling, offering a peaceful escape. Soğuksu National Park is highly recommended for its rich vegetation, diverse wildlife, and varied routes. Karagöl Nature Park, with its volcanic lake, also provides a significant spot for hikers, particularly beautiful in summer or autumn.
While specific public transport details for every trailhead can vary, many areas closer to the city, such as Eymir Lake, are generally accessible. For national parks and more remote locations like Soğuksu National Park or Karagöl, it's often more convenient to use private transport or local shuttle services. Always check local transport options for your chosen trailhead.
Ankara offers hiking opportunities throughout the year, with each season presenting a unique experience. Spring and autumn are particularly pleasant, with mild temperatures and vibrant colors. Spring brings lush greenery, while autumn transforms forests into golden landscapes. Even winter offers snow-covered scenery in areas like Soğuksu National Park for those prepared for colder conditions.
Many natural areas and parks around Ankara are generally dog-friendly, especially for walks on a leash. Lakeside trails, such as those around Eymir Lake, are popular spots for dog owners. However, it's always advisable to check specific park regulations or local signage regarding pets before heading out, especially in national parks or protected areas.
